Side-by-Side Comparison
| Prayer | Delhi | Močiar |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fajr الفجر | 3:49 AM | 2:20 AM | 89m earlier |
| Sunrise الشروق | 5:23 AM | 4:42 AM | 41m earlier |
| Dhuhr الظهر | 12:22 PM | 12:46 PM | 24m later |
| Asr العصر | 3:54 PM | 5:02 PM | 68m later |
| Maghrib المغرب | 7:21 PM | 8:49 PM | 88m later |
| Isha العشاء | 8:56 PM | 11:11 PM | 135m later |
